## Recovery: Order-Cutoff Override

Hey new folks — Crumbleton Bakery's system locks custom orders at 14:00 sharp. If a manager gets locked out mid-override, recover their account through the Flourdeck admin panel. The panel asks for the team recovery passphrase before it'll budge, so keep it handy. It's noted just below.

recovery phrase for fawif-tajeg: norael-aldmir-casir-brivan-ulaion

Agreed: the force-directed layout will be capped and fall back to the layered renderer, with a warning banner rather than a silent switch. On-call should know that a stalled render no longer indicates a backend fault — check the client console first before paging the graph service. Cache invalidation for edge metadata was also discussed and deferred. Any escalation about visualizer behavior should go to the person named here.

account owner for bawip-tahag: Raleth Quenok

Handover note — Crumbwheel order cutoffs.

Welcome aboard. The bakery cutoff rule in Crumbwheel closes same-day orders at 14:00 local to each storefront, not UTC — this has bitten us twice. Holiday overrides live in the calendar service and take precedence silently, so always check there first when a cutoff looks wrong. To unlock the calendar service's admin console after a restart, enter the recovery passphrase below.

vault phrase of bagap-bahaf = silion-pelox-sorox-casdor-quenwyn-fraax-eliox-praael-kelion-quenvan-kasox-rusael-norius-belvan

When a user uploads a text file to Plaintext Harbor, we never trust the declared charset. The sniffer reads a bounded prefix, scores candidate encodings, and falls back to a safe default if confidence is low. These thresholds were calibrated against the Orvane sample corpus and should not be changed casually — small shifts cause silent mojibake in exports. The sniffer is governed by the constants below.

tuning table, faduf-baduf:
PRIORITIES = {
    "ulavan": 191,
    "silys": 750,
    "goriel": 238,
    "kelmir": 66,
    "wendor": 432,
}